Worth mentioning: most effective ways to study anatomy is through visual learning. Diagrams, illustrations, and 3D models can help you visualize complex structures and relationships. Many educational resources offer interactive tools that allow you to rotate, zoom, and explore different parts of the body. Worth adding: using these visual aids not only enhances your memory retention but also makes the learning process more engaging. Additionally, watching videos or attending lectures can provide context and deeper insights into how anatomical structures function in real-life situations.

Another essential strategy is to practice active learning. Still, this involves engaging with the material through note-taking, summarizing key points, and teaching the concepts to others. Active learning reinforces your understanding and helps identify areas that need further clarification. Creating flashcards for definitions, symptoms, or processes can also be a powerful tool. By regularly reviewing these materials, you strengthen your memory and confirm that the information sticks.

Breaking down complex topics into smaller, manageable sections is another effective approach. So instead of trying to absorb everything at once, focus on one topic at a time. Start with basic concepts and gradually build up to more advanced ideas. This method prevents overwhelm and allows you to retain information more effectively. Additionally, using mnemonics can help you remember key terms and relationships. Here's a good example: associating a specific muscle with its location or function can make it easier to recall later.

Engaging in practical exercises is also crucial. Worth adding: hands-on activities such as dissecting models, using anatomical charts, or even conducting simple experiments can deepen your understanding. These experiences help you connect theoretical knowledge with real-world applications. Even so, if possible, seek opportunities to work with anatomical models or participate in group discussions. Collaborating with peers can also provide new perspectives and enhance your learning.

Another important aspect of studying anatomy and physiology is consistency. Still, regular study sessions are more effective than last-minute cramming. Set aside dedicated time each day or week to review the material. Over time, this consistent effort will lead to better retention and a stronger grasp of the subject.
